Transaction 4e7bbd23f3648150a17492356471a7d28335eb65868ce79685f1eb82fcb5a20f

1 Input
2 Outputs
  • 4e7bbd23f3648150a17492356471a7d28335eb65868ce79685f1eb82fcb5a20f:0
  • value  1088805
    address  113296EFgMxtGASD5XoqtS4an8A5AjxCEF
  • 4e7bbd23f3648150a17492356471a7d28335eb65868ce79685f1eb82fcb5a20f:1
  • value  5934491
    address  3QmhpBcbsUPDAzmSPiNrttVbARsC7tTSif